The invention relates to a super plasticizer for a precast concrete component, and the super plasticizer is prepared by carrying out free radical copolymerization reaction on monomer a, monomer b, monomer c and monomer d in an aqueous medium, and adding alkali compound into the reaction product for neutralization, wherein the molar ratio among the monomer a, the monomer b, the monomer c and the monomer d is 1.0:(5.0-16.0):(1.0-4.0):(2.0-6.0). Compared with the traditional high efficiency water reducing agent, the admixture has the characteristics that (1) the early hydration of the cement is obviously improved, the compression strength of the concrete is improved, and especially the early strength is improved; (2) the problem of slump loss caused by polyether long side chain belt can be greatly improved, so that the slump loss resistance of the concrete is improved, and the requirements of pumping pipe pile concrete can be met; and (3) under the condition of low amount of admixture, the super plasticizer for the precast concrete component has remarkable dispersing performance, slump-retaining capability and enhancement effect, is especially remarkable in early enhancement effect, is very remarkable in the early enhancement effect at the room temperature or low temperature, and is stable in later strength increment, thus being conductive to accelerating the turnover of templates, and accelerating the construction progress.
